Third of my new TGS soaps today and second shave with the Supply SE...

Software:
Glyce Lime pre-shave wash | TGS Pino Alpestre shaving soap | Proraso Menthol & Eucalyptus splash

Hardware: Yaqi Dandelion 24mm Cashmere | Supply SE V2 Custom Injector (Plate 3) | Personna blade

DSC_1164.jpg

Pino Alpestre is a very nice fresh-scented shaving soap from TGS. Again, it's not overpowering but it does have a subtle mountain pine forest sort of fragrance. The Dandelion lathered it well and held held plenty of soap for a face-lathered three-pass shave.

I was a little more confidant in my second outing with the Supply V2 and only used plate 3 - the most aggressive - for the whole shave. It's certainly my best experience with a SE to date. I put that down to paying attention to the advice: no pressure, let the head do the work, find your angle, small movements etc. In addition, I found that very frequent razor rinsing helps a lot.

I did need three passes though and not too sure of the Personna blade. If anyones got any suggestions for the best blade to use with the V2 I'd love to hear them!

“There is no such thing as failure only feedback” Thanks for your honesty, I respect that.
It has a deep earthy smell, as is the case of shaving soap, bar soap and liquid soaps made using raw goats milk to mix potassium and sodium hydroxide. The upside is goats milk soaps seem to be good for those with eczema, psoriasis and those with particular skin sensitivities. I'm going to do a few fragranced goats milk ones so will send samples gor you to test shave.

All good - scent-wise - keeping it old school - the disparate elements - worked together well. Another single pass shave - this may be the way forward for me - experience allows me to adapt it to my beard growth - as said before - 95% result - with less than half the effort - fewer passes are better - lets face it - human skin didn't evolve to have surgically sharp steel dragged across it several times a week. It is a cultural choice we make. That - of course - set against justifying - to our partners - the amount of shaving porn we own. :cool:
